]> git.r.bdr.sh - rbdr/dotfiles/blame - vim/colors/darkspectrum.vim
Add karabiner files
[rbdr/dotfiles] / vim / colors / darkspectrum.vim
CommitLineData
0d23b6e5
BB
1" Vim color file
2"
3" Author: Brian Mock <mock.brian@gmail.com>
4"
5" Note: Based on Oblivion color scheme for gedit (gtk-source-view)
6"
7" cool help screens
8" :he group-name
9" :he highlight-groups
10" :he cterm-colors
11
12hi clear
13
14set background=dark
15if version > 580
16 " no guarantees for version 5.8 and below, but this makes it stop
17 " complaining
18 hi clear
19 if exists("syntax_on")
20 syntax reset
21 endif
22endif
23let g:colors_name="darkspectrum"
24
25hi Normal guifg=#efefef guibg=#2A2A2A
26
27" highlight groups
28hi Cursor guibg=#ffffff guifg=#000000
29hi CursorLine guibg=#000000
30"hi CursorLine guibg=#3e4446
31hi CursorColumn guibg=#464646
32
33"hi DiffText guibg=#4e9a06 guifg=#FFFFFF gui=bold
34"hi DiffChange guibg=#4e9a06 guifg=#FFFFFF gui=bold
35"hi DiffAdd guibg=#204a87 guifg=#FFFFFF gui=bold
36"hi DiffDelete guibg=#5c3566 guifg=#FFFFFF gui=bold
37
38hi DiffAdd guifg=#ffcc7f guibg=#a67429 gui=none
39hi DiffChange guifg=#7fbdff guibg=#425c78 gui=none
40hi DiffText guifg=#8ae234 guibg=#4e9a06 gui=none
41"hi DiffDelete guifg=#252723 guibg=#000000 gui=none
42hi DiffDelete guifg=#000000 guibg=#000000 gui=none
43"hi ErrorMsg
44
45hi Number guifg=#fce94f
46
47hi Folded guibg=#000000 guifg=#FFFFFF gui=bold
48hi vimFold guibg=#000000 guifg=#FFFFFF gui=bold
49hi FoldColumn guibg=#000000 guifg=#FFFFFF gui=bold
50
51hi LineNr guifg=#535353 guibg=#202020
52hi NonText guifg=#535353 guibg=#202020
53hi Folded guifg=#535353 guibg=#202020 gui=bold
54hi FoldeColumn guifg=#535353 guibg=#202020 gui=bold
55"hi VertSplit guibg=#ffffff guifg=#ffffff gui=none
56
57hi VertSplit guibg=#3C3C3C guifg=#3C3C3C gui=none
58hi StatusLine guifg=#FFFFFF guibg=#3C3C3C gui=none
59hi StatusLineNC guifg=#808080 guibg=#3C3C3C gui=none
60
61hi ModeMsg guifg=#fce94f
62hi MoreMsg guifg=#fce94f
63hi Visual guifg=#FFFFFF guibg=#3465a4 gui=none
64hi VisualNOS guifg=#FFFFFF guibg=#204a87 gui=none
65hi IncSearch guibg=#FFFFFF guifg=#ef5939
66hi Search guibg=#ad7fa8 guifg=#FFFFFF
67hi SpecialKey guifg=#8ae234
68
69hi Title guifg=#ef5939
70hi WarningMsg guifg=#ef5939
71hi Number guifg=#fcaf3e
72
73hi MatchParen guibg=#ad7fa8 guifg=#FFFFFF
74hi Comment guifg=#8a8a8a
75hi Constant guifg=#ef5939 gui=none
76hi String guifg=#fce94f
77hi Identifier guifg=#729fcf
78hi Statement guifg=#ffffff gui=bold
79hi PreProc guifg=#ffffff gui=bold
80hi Type guifg=#8ae234 gui=bold
81hi Special guifg=#e9b96e
82hi Underlined guifg=#ad7fa8 gui=underline
83hi Directory guifg=#729fcf
84hi Ignore guifg=#555753
85hi Todo guifg=#FFFFFF guibg=#ef5939 gui=bold
86hi Function guifg=#ad7fa8
87
88"hi WildMenu guibg=#2e3436 guifg=#ffffff gui=bold
89"hi WildMenu guifg=#7fbdff guibg=#425c78 gui=none
90hi WildMenu guifg=#ffffff guibg=#3465a4 gui=none
91
92hi Pmenu guibg=#000000 guifg=#c0c0c0
93hi PmenuSel guibg=#3465a4 guifg=#ffffff
94hi PmenuSbar guibg=#444444 guifg=#444444
95hi PmenuThumb guibg=#888888 guifg=#888888
96
97hi cppSTLType guifg=#729fcf gui=bold
98
99hi spellBad guisp=#fcaf3e
100hi spellCap guisp=#73d216
101hi spellRare guisp=#ad7fa8
102hi spellLocal guisp=#729fcf
103
104hi link cppSTL Function
105hi link Error Todo
106hi link Character Number
107hi link rubySymbol Number
108hi link htmlTag htmlEndTag
109"hi link htmlTagName htmlTag
110hi link htmlLink Underlined
111hi link pythonFunction Identifier
112hi link Question Type
113hi link CursorIM Cursor
114hi link VisualNOS Visual
115hi link xmlTag Identifier
116hi link xmlTagName Identifier
117hi link shDeref Identifier
118hi link shVariable Function
119hi link rubySharpBang Special
120hi link perlSharpBang Special
121hi link schemeFunc Statement
122"hi link shSpecialVariables Constant
123"hi link bashSpecialVariables Constant
124
125" tabs (non gui)
126hi TabLine guifg=#A3A3A3 guibg=#202020 gui=none
127hi TabLineFill guifg=#535353 guibg=#202020 gui=none
128hi TabLineSel guifg=#FFFFFF gui=bold
129"hi TabLineSel guifg=#FFFFFF guibg=#000000 gui=bold
130" vim: sw=4 ts=4